Here's how they look out of the mold and then painted.
If you make sure all the hooks are seated properly in the mold you dont get a bit of flash. The unpainted jig you see pictured below was out of the mold in that condition.NO trimming needed. Even if you do happen to get a batch with flash around them it only takes a few seconds a jig to scrape it off with you fingernail.
